# Heads up for the release notes: the Fernwick catalog endpoint was hammering
# Postgres with one query per product variant — classic N+1 via the GraphQL
# resolver chain. We now batch-load variants with a dataloader keyed on
# product ID, which cut query counts from ~400 to 3 per request. The batch
# sizes below were tuned against staging traffic replays. Here are the
# constants we shipped:

tuning table, yajog-yahof:
BUDGETS = {
    "lamvan": 303,
    "wenox": 460,
    "fenvan": 525,
}

14:22 — Alerts fired on Threadline event consumers; schema registry at Norpoint returning 500s. 14:25 — Confirmed registry pods crash-looping after compatibility-check change deployed at 14:10. 14:31 — Rolled back registry to prior release; consumers recovered by 14:38. 14:45 — Producers with cached schemas were unaffected; only new schema registrations failed. Root cause: null default handling in the new validator. Rollback was clean; no data loss. The rolled-back deployment corresponds to the trace token recorded below.

build token for bahip-fawif: htk3_6a1

Subject: Door sensor recall — Vextor House

New starters: the magnetic door sensors on floors 2–4 are being recalled by the supplier. Until replacements arrive, the side doors won't auto-release. Use the main lobby entrance only. Don't prop doors. The lobby reader still works normally. Swipe in as usual with the temporary access code below.

staff pass of kawip-hawef = bdg-QLP-2